Religion in Wamuran

What people believe — religious affiliation and those with no religion.

More people in Wamuran report having no religion than in most similar areas. While Christianity remains the most common faith at 47.3%, a large portion of the community identifies as non-religious.

Religious affiliation

The mix of religions, and people with no religion.

About 44.2% of residents have no religion, which is well above the Australian figure of 38.9% and a little above the Queensland rate. Other faiths are less common, with Buddhism at 0.8% and Hinduism at 0.1%.

44.2% ▲ +79.7%

Higher than 62% of suburb / locality areas.

  • 2011: 24.6%
  • 2016: 28.3%
  • 2021: 44.2%

Share of people reporting no religion (incl. secular and other spiritual beliefs).
